A clip lives or dies in the first seconds of a scroll. Four levers decide which way it goes — and the first one decides whether the other three are ever seen.
The hook — second 0 to 1.5
The one the other three depend on.
The viewer's attention is already shattered when your clip hits the feed — 11 things watched in the last 2 minutes, the next swipe a millimeter away.
Your first sentence has to land before they decide.
Machine-gun pacing
Every "um," every pause, every breath that doesn't earn its place — cut.
The feed pays for watch-time. So do we.
The retention loop
Open one question early. Pay it off at the very end.
They can't leave while the loop is open.
The cover frame
The one frame the feed shows before playback.
If it doesn't stop the thumb, none of the editing matters.
